Fantasy Court takes place on Sunday, June 8, 2025, on the Koeveld of the Technische Universiteit Eindhoven (TU/e) campus (Den Dolech 12, TU/e, Eindhoven). The planned end of setup is at 10:30 in anticipation of the official start at 11:00, and the festival comes to a close at 18:00. The intent is to make it a nice and comfortable late-morning and afternoon experience.
There are many tall buildings on the TU/e campus. The Fantasy Court field is located in the airwake of one of these buildings, which sometimes causes sudden heavy gusts of wind. As a consequence of this, the organization has on occasion needed to help some vendors in previous years to chase down “runaway” merchandise. We ask everyone to take the wind into account when planning your stand setup. The gusts of wind are unpredictable, so it is not possible to arrange a place that will reliably be out of the wind.
We recommend prevention methods such as anchoring down your stall with elastic cords and anchoring tents with tension lines/guy lines. Merchandise can be secured using clamps or zip-ties. It is also wise to weigh down small containers. If you offer very lightweight goods, it may be worthwhile to invest in a tarp to hang behind your stall.
Due to campus policy, tent pegs must generally be pushed no further than 15 cm into the ground. If you need to use deeper anchors, contact us, as there are certain sections of the site where they are permitted and we may be able to arrange something for you.
Just like last year, LARP organizations are welcome to present themselves at Fantasy Court. It is possible at our event to introduce new people to the wide world of LARP. It is a lovely place to promote your own organization and get new players interested. Charities and non-profits are also welcome to take part in the festival if they are related to the concept of fantasy. Feel free to contact us to discuss the possibilities.

As usual, there will again be a market! Picture stalls that sell things related to LARP, roleplaying games, or board games, or something else related to the Fantasy genre. This ranges from jewelry and costumes to books and dice. There are of course reserved places for stalls that sell food and drink.
It is also possible to rent a stall and chairs through our organisation, depending on availability and your specific wishes. These will be rented directly from our supplier. It is of course also permitted to bring your own materials such as tents, stalls, or benches, on the condition that we know the details in advance (for the purposes of planning the field layout). This information can be filled into the registration form.
